I just did this a few days ago with my first generation iPod Touch, and it is by far the best thing I have ever done with it. It honestly is almost like having a completely different device. I can easily multitask between as many apps as I have the ram for, completely customize the looks of the OS, and get a crapload of other free apps. It is impossible do describe how much awesomer my iPod is now.
I decided to go for it as the first gen iPod Touches and iphones do not support iOS 4, and only the most recent ones support multitasking. I used this tool to do it:
http://spiritjb.com/
It was very easy, and took only a few minutes. My only complaint is that Cydia, the app store equivalent, is pretty slow, but there are other ones you can get.

Here's what I've installed so far:
Activator- lets you control how to activate background tasks like multitasking
Android Battery- does what it says
Backgrounder- lets you run apps in the background
ProSwitcher- lets me switch the open apps Palm Pre style
Grooveshark- lets me listen to any song I can think of
Poof- lets me hide unwanted icons
Quake 3
ReflectiveDock
Safari Download Plugin- lets me download files through the web browser
SBsettings- the pulldown show above
WeatherIcon- puts live weather info in the icon
WinterBoard- the first thing I installed, lets me customize the UI
